Product Details

Shop for high-quality 40 Amp 600 Volt Stud Blocking Diode at Ubuy curacao. Get the best deals and fast shipping for your electrical projects.
  • 40A, 600V stud blocking diode for wind generator or solar panel applications
  • Diode should be rated for 1.5 times the maximum amperage output
  • Suitable for DC wind generators or solar panels generating 27 Amps or less
  • Can handle up to 40 Amps but not recommended for continuous duty at that level
  • Allows electricity to flow from wind generator to battery bank for charging
  • Prevents electricity from flowing from battery bank to wind generator

Customer Questions & Answers

  • Question: What is a Stud Blocking Diode used for?

    Answer: A Stud Blocking Diode is primarily used to prevent reverse current flow in electrical circuits. This is crucial in applications like solar power systems, where you want to ensure energy flows in one direction. They are often used in battery charging systems to protect batteries from discharge through the charging source. Ideal for high-current applications, these diodes help maintain system efficiency and longevity.
  • Question: What are the key specifications of a 40 Amp 600 Volt Stud Blocking Diode?

    Answer: A 40 Amp 600 Volt Stud Blocking Diode features a maximum forward current rating of 40 Amperes and withstands voltage levels up to 600 Volts. These specifications make it suitable for high-voltage and high-power applications, ensuring robust performance. Users will find these diodes useful in scenarios requiring high reliability, such as industrial machinery and renewable energy systems, where significant electrical load is often present.
  • Question: How do I install a 40 Amp 600 Volt Stud Blocking Diode?

    Answer: Installing a Stud Blocking Diode involves connecting it correctly in the circuit. Typically, the diode is mounted onto a heat sink to dissipate heat effectively. Ensure the correct orientation; the anode must connect to the positive side of the circuit while the cathode goes to the load. Proper installation helps protect against back-voltage spikes that could damage components, making it essential for safety and performance in applications such as automotive and power electronics.
  • Question: What are the advantages of using a Stud Blocking Diode?

    Answer: Using a Stud Blocking Diode brings several advantages, including protection against reverse current, improved circuit efficiency, and enhanced system reliability. This diode's design enables it to handle high current loads without failing, making it suitable for critical systems like solar inverters and battery management systems. In scenarios where system integrity is paramount, incorporating these diodes ensures that components are safeguarded from potential damage due to incorrect current flow.
  • Question: Can a 40 Amp 600 Volt Stud Blocking Diode be used in high-temperature environments?

    Answer: Yes, many 40 Amp 600 Volt Stud Blocking Diodes are designed to operate effectively in high-temperature environments. However, it’s essential to check the manufacturer's specifications for maximum operating temperatures. Using these diodes in high-temperature settings, such as automotive applications or industrial machinery, requires appropriate thermal management. Adequate heatsinking and thermal insulation methods can enhance diode longevity and performance in these demanding conditions.
  • Question: What types of applications typically use Stud Blocking Diodes?

    Answer: Stud Blocking Diodes are widely used in various applications such as solar power systems, automotive electrical systems, and industrial machinery. They are essential in battery charging systems to prevent backflow energy that can damage the battery. Additionally, they play a crucial role in power supplies where reverse polarity could lead to system failures. Their versatility makes them indispensable in any high-voltage, high-current application where component protection is critical.
  • Question: How does a blocking diode affect circuit performance?

    Answer: A blocking diode influences circuit performance primarily by allowing current to flow in one direction while preventing reverse flow. This characteristic helps maintain circuit efficiency, preventing any potential back current that could harm other components. In systems like solar panels, the diode ensures that power generated flows into the load instead of back into the panel, optimizing overall energy use. Its presence is critical in maximizing performance and ensuring reliability.
  • Question: What should I consider when choosing a blocking diode for my application?

    Answer: When choosing a blocking diode, consider the maximum current and voltage ratings required for your application. Additionally, factor in environmental conditions such as temperature and humidity, which might impact performance. The recovery time, thermal resistance, and physical size should also be evaluated based on installation requirements. Selecting the right diode ensures it meets the specific electrical characteristics and operational conditions of your application, which is crucial for system reliability.

WindyNation Solar & Wind Power Parts & Accessories Editorial Review

The 40 Amp 600 Volt Stud Blocking Diode is a reliable and useful product suitable for preventing voltage from going in the reverse direction. Customers have used it to solve power feedback on a DC circuit, on the output side of a bridge rectifier, and to prevent a single deep cycle battery from discharging if a 12v solar panel charge controller fails. It can also be used to isolate the wind turbine output from another battery charging controller. The product is effective in its use and can be mounted securely in a rotating assembly as it comes with two non-matching ends.
